Breaking Down the Features of Demco Baseplate Locking Pin Kit – 5/8″
Specifications
The Demco Baseplate Locking Pin Kit – 5/8″ includes one pair of 5/8″ bent pin locks. This is the standard size for most baseplate and tow bar connections, ensuring compatibility with a wide range of towing setups.
It also includes two keys for unlocking the pins. Having two keys is a welcome addition, providing a backup in case one is lost or misplaced.
The pins are constructed from high-strength steel. This ensures durability and resistance to bending or breakage under the stress of towing.
These specifications are essential because they directly impact the security and reliability of the towing connection. The 5/8″ diameter is a standard, ensuring compatibility; the high-strength steel provides peace of mind during towing, and the included keys offer convenience and security.

Durability & Maintenance
The high-strength steel construction ensures that the Demco Baseplate Locking Pin Kit – 5/8″ is built to last. With proper care and maintenance, it should provide years of reliable service.
Maintenance is minimal, requiring only occasional lubrication of the locking cylinders. The robust construction and simple design contribute to its longevity.
